Solution Overview

Problem

Existing image display apparatuses face challenges in stably outputting sound when connected wirelessly to external sound output devices, due to limitations in wireless connectivity and the need for simultaneous sound output.

Innovation Solution

The image display apparatus is equipped with a display, an audio output device, a wired interface for data exchange with external sound output devices, a wireless communication device for wireless data exchange, and a signal processing device that manages audio signals in various formats to ensure stable wireless transmission and simultaneous sound output.

Solution Approach 1:

The system dynamically adjusts the audio signal format based on wireless transmission conditions. When retransmission requests exceed a reference value, the signal processing device switches from a first audio format to a second audio format, optimizing transmission stability while maintaining wireless connectivity convenience

AI summary

An image display apparatus is disclosed. The image display apparatus according to an embodiment of the present disclosure comprises: a display; an audio output device; an interface to exchange data with an external sound output device in a wired manner; a wireless communication device to exchange data with the external sound output device in a wireless manner; and a signal processing device to, in a simultaneous sound output mode and in a mode of wireless transmission to the external sound output device, output a first audio signal to the audio output device, and wirelessly transmit a second audio signal based on a first format, and, in response to a number of retransmission requests from the external sound output device being greater than or equal to a reference value, wirelessly transmit an audio signal based on a second format. Accordingly, it is possible to stably output sound through the external sound output device wirelessly connected to the image display apparatus
